The first question is a comment left by a subscriber

who is worried that the shape of their nasal tip is not maintained even after revision surgery~

The answer to this question is that the surgery just needs to be done well!

In rhinoplasty, the strength and direction of the strut graft,

and harmony with the skin condition are very important.

Everyone's nasal tip droops when they smile!

At this time, there are people whose nasal tip droops a lot

and people whose tip droops less.

Depending on that, under a precise diagnosis,

the surgery is performed slightly differently in terms of the direction or strength of the strut graft.

If the surgery is done too strongly at this time,

the nasal tip may not move, which can be uncomfortable!

The second question is related to columella surgery.

You were wondering if columellaplasty and a columellar strut graft

are the same surgery!

The columella is the pillar of the nose.

Common problems include a drooping columella or

one that goes inward, making it look like a so-called pig nose.

Correcting that shape is called columellaplasty,

and in the case of a columellar strut graft, it has a

very close relationship with a septal extension graft.

Usually, to raise the nose significantly,

a septal extension graft is performed.

If the septum is insufficient

but the patient wants surgery using only autologous tissue,

a columellar strut graft is incorporated.

Because this surgical method involves less of the hard part of the septum

and more of the soft part of the ear cartilage,

the nasal tip can be somewhat softer.

The third question is about a dorsal hump nose!

If a nose that is high but has a slightly bumpy hump

is only shaved down, the nose will completely sink,

which can make it look like a 'saddle nose'

with a depression on the bridge like a horse saddle.

In this case, shaving it down appropriately and inserting

autologous cartilage into the upper and lower parts of the hump

is the way to make the nose line neat and clean.

The fifth question is about reducing a bulbous nasal tip.

Bulbous nasal tip reduction is bulbous nose surgery.

You can make the nasal tip smaller just by alar reduction

through cartilage tying and fat removal,

but this is usually limited to foreigners with thin skin.

For Koreans with thick skin on the nasal tip,

the nose must be raised together to see a noticeable effect.

The last question is about private health insurance for rhinoplasty!

I have a deviated nose and sometimes hear snoring when I lie down.

Can this be covered by private health insurance during surgery?

Yes, it can. Then, if the septum is deviated,

private health insurance coverage is possible for septoplasty.
